EdgeOS Inventory and Order Management System
EdgeOS acts as the core technology platform managing inventory, orders and warehouse operations. It delivers live inventory insights across nodes, allowing companies to monitor stock position and flow. Such transparency helps avoid overselling, delays and excess stock movement.
It features batch-level tracking, expiry control and organised stock rotation. FIFO and FEFO processes can be enforced according to product requirements. These controls are especially valuable for categories where production dates, shelf life or batch identification affect quality and compliance.
The platform integrates with 50+ marketplaces and 20+ courier partners. These integrations help brands bring orders from different channels into one Warehousing & Fulfilment operating environment. Staff can manage orders, stock and deliveries through a unified digital system.

AI-Powered Logistics Optimisation
The company’s AI layer, EdgeAPEX, supports demand forecasting, return-to-origin prediction and fulfilment optimisation. The system processes real inventory data from multiple storage points. It enables data-driven decisions for inventory allocation and fulfilment planning.
Forecasting tools allow businesses to predict demand and allocate stock accordingly. Better placement may reduce long-distance shipping, stockouts and delayed deliveries. This ensures balanced inventory distribution across regions.
RTO prediction is a key feature for ecommerce operations in India. High return rates raise logistics costs, lock inventory and impact margins. Predictive insights allow brands to identify patterns, improve order decisions and take suitable action before unnecessary costs increase.
In-Plant Warehouse Operations
Some businesses already own warehouses but lack the technology, processes or trained teams needed to run them efficiently. The company solves this through in-plant operational services. In this model, skilled teams and EdgeOS are implemented within the client’s warehouse.
This enables companies to keep their infrastructure while improving operations. The on-site team manages inventory, workflows, orders, reporting and performance. It provides an alternative to fully outsourcing logistics or attempting to improve complicated operations without specialist support.
It is especially useful for producers expanding into direct-to-consumer sales. They often have storage but require new workflows for ecommerce, packaging and returns. This ensures existing warehouses can support modern fulfilment requirements.
